The Closer Returns for a Holiday Special
Sunday December 3, 2006
Are you suffering from The Closer withdrawal? Fifteen episodes a year just doesn't seem to be enough to satisfy our cravings for Brenda's southern hospitality, quick wit and secret chocolate addiction, does it? Luckily TNT has found a way to take the edge off until season three premieres next year. On Monday night, The Closer returns for a special two-hour episode. And if that's not enough, Kyra Sedgwick’s real life hubby, movie star Kevin Bacon, directed hour two. In this episode, Deputy Chief Johnson is visited by her former CIA mentor to help in an off-the-record investigation of a would-be defector found murdered in Los Angeles. Brenda must find the common thread linking a former KGB agent, the murder of several CIA agents, a young Lebanese boy thought to be a terrorist and 20 pounds of missing plutonium. The two-hour special airs Monday, December 4 at 8pm EST, with an encore at 10pm EST on TNT.
